Output d2aa0a06bcce32505dd95c32f2b136e6a992f7dbfa56c03172adf34371c7d6a3:0

value
169649
script pubkey
OP_0 OP_PUSHBYTES_20 fbd09102c6d3a40988829b25248ea0bb5bf7d15c
address
bc1ql0gfzqkx6wjqnzyznvjjfr4qhddl052uvpct3e
transaction
d2aa0a06bcce32505dd95c32f2b136e6a992f7dbfa56c03172adf34371c7d6a3
confirmations
138870
spent
true